a) Installation work and electrical wiring must be done by qualified person(s) in accordance with all applicable codes
and standards, including fire-rated construction codes and standards.
b) Sufficient air is needed for proper combustion and exhausting of gasses through the flue (chimney) of fuel burning
equipment to prevent back drafting. Follow the heating equipment manufacturer's guidelines and safety standards
such as those published by the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) and the American Society for Heating,
Refrigeration and Air Conditioning Engineers (ASHRAE) and the local code authorities.
c) When cutting or drilling into wall or ceiling, do not damage electrical wiring and other hidden utilities.
d) Ducted fans must always be vented to the outdoor.
e) For safe and secure wall mounting, the TRADE-WIND® BBQ Hood should be mounted to a solid vertical surface of
sufficient width to allow for mounting of the Hood. The horizontal surface should extend from a vertical plane to the
point directly in front of the exhaust roof cap (or wall cap).
f) The Hood should be installed with a MINIMUM of three (3) feet of weather proof roof coverage on all sides that are
not protected from direct rain by an adjacent wall.
g) It is also required that all duct work and roof openings be thoroughly sealed with the applicable tape and/or roof
sealant to prevent ingress of water.

RECOMMENDATIONS:
Consult a licensed ventilation contractor or qualified technician for proper installation of exhaust ducting. Locate the
cooking area for minimum cross drafts-away from doors and windows, when possible.
Ducts must be of adequate size and duct runs should be as short as possible. Where turns are necessary, keep
turning radius as large and as smooth as possible.
The ducting must be air tight. Use a minimum of 2 sheet metal screws at every duct joint. Then, seal the duct joints
with high quality duct tape.
Do not use this unit with any solid-state speed control device.
This unit must be grounded.

WARNING! TO REDUCE THE RISK OF FIRE, USE ONLY METAL DUCTWORK.
CAUTION: To reduce the risk of fire and to properly exhaust air, be sure to duct air outside. Do not vent exhaust air
into spaces within walls, ceilings, cabinets or into attics, crawl spaces, or garages.

WARNING! TO REDUCE THE RISK OF INJURY TO PERSONS IN THE EVENT OF A BBQ TOP GREASE FIRE, OBSERVING THE
FOLLOWING:

a) Smother flames with a close-fitting lid, cookie sheet, or metal tray, then turn off the burner.
b) Never pick up a flaming pan -- you will be burned.
c) Do not use water, including wet dishcloths or towels. A violent steam explosion will result.
d) Use an extinguisher only if:
1. You know you have a Class ABC extinguisher and you already know how to operate it.
2. The fire is small and contained in the area where it started.
3. The fire department is being called.
4. You can fight the fire with your back to an exit.
e) Follow the BBQ grill manufacturer's instruction when using gas grills, cookers, or any propane appliances.
f) Be careful to prevent burns. If the flame does not go out directly, evacuate and call the fire department.
